package io
import (
"os"
"path/filepath"
"testing"
"github.com/go-rat/utils/env"
"github.com/stretchr/testify/suite"
)
type IOTestSuite struct {
suite.Suite
}
func TestIOTestSuite(t *testing.T) {
suite.Run(t, &IOTestSuite{})
}
func (s *IOTestSuite) SetupTest() {
if _, err := os.Stat("testdata"); os.IsNotExist(err) {
s.NoError(os.MkdirAll("testdata", 0755))
}
}
func (s *IOTestSuite) TearDownTest() {
s.NoError(os.RemoveAll("testdata"))
}
func (s *IOTestSuite) TestWriteCreatesFileWithCorrectContent() {
path := "testdata/write_test.txt"
data := "Hello, World!"
permission := os.FileMode(0644)
s.NoError(Write(path, data, permission))
content, err := Read(path)
s.NoError(err)
s.Equal(data, content)
}
func (s *IOTestSuite) TestWriteAppendAppendsToFile() {
path := "testdata/append_test.txt"
initialData := "Hello"
appendData := ", World!"
s.NoError(Write(path, initialData, 0644))
s.NoError(WriteAppend(path, appendData, 0644))
content, err := Read(path)
s.NoError(err)
s.Equal("Hello, World!", content)
}

func (s *IOTestSuite) TestRemoveDeletesFileOrDirectory() {
path := "testdata/remove_test"
s.NoError(os.MkdirAll(path, 0755))
s.DirExists(path)
s.NoError(Remove(path))
s.NoDirExists(path)
}
func (s *IOTestSuite) TestChmodChangesPermissions() {
if env.IsWindows() {
s.T().Skip("Skipping on Windows")
}
path := "testdata/chmod_test.txt"
s.NoError(Write(path, "test", 0644))
s.NoError(Chmod(path, 0755))
info, err := os.Stat(path)
s.NoError(err)
s.Equal(os.FileMode(0755), info.Mode().Perm())
}
func (s *IOTestSuite) TestChownChangesOwner() {
if env.IsWindows() {
s.T().Skip("Skipping on Windows")
}
path := "testdata/chown_test.txt"
s.NoError(Write(path, "test", 0644))
s.NoError(Chown(path, "root", "root"))
}
func (s *IOTestSuite) TestExistsReturnsTrueForExistingPath() {
path := "testdata/exists_test.txt"
s.NoError(Write(path, "test", 0644))
s.True(Exists(path))
}
func (s *IOTestSuite) TestExistsReturnsFalseForNonExistingPath() {
path := "testdata/nonexistent.txt"
s.False(Exists(path))
}
func (s *IOTestSuite) TestEmptyReturnsTrueForEmptyDirectory() {
path := "testdata/empty_test"
s.NoError(os.MkdirAll(path, 0755))
s.True(Empty(path))
}
func (s *IOTestSuite) TestEmptyReturnsFalseForNonEmptyDirectory() {
path := "testdata/nonempty_test"
s.NoError(os.MkdirAll(path, 0755))
s.NoError(Write(filepath.Join(path, "file.txt"), "test", 0644))
s.False(Empty(path))
}
func (s *IOTestSuite) TestMvMovesFile() {
src := "testdata/mv_src.txt"
dst := "testdata/mv_dst.txt"
s.NoError(Write(src, "test", 0644))
s.NoError(Mv(src, dst))
s.FileExists(dst)
s.NoFileExists(src)
}
func (s *IOTestSuite) TestCpCopiesFile() {
src := "testdata/cp_src.txt"
dst := "testdata/cp_dst.txt"
s.NoError(Write(src, "test", 0644))
s.NoError(Cp(src, dst))
s.FileExists(dst)
s.FileExists(src)
}
func (s *IOTestSuite) TestSizeReturnsCorrectSize() {
path := "testdata/size_test.txt"
data := "12345"
s.NoError(Write(path, data, 0644))
size, err := Size(path)
s.NoError(err)
s.Equal(int64(len(data)), size)
}
func (s *IOTestSuite) TestIsDirReturnsTrueForDirectory() {
path := "testdata/isdir_test"
s.NoError(os.MkdirAll(path, 0755))
s.True(IsDir(path))
}
func (s *IOTestSuite) TestIsDirReturnsFalseForFile() {
path := "testdata/isfile_test.txt"
s.NoError(Write(path, "test", 0644))
s.False(IsDir(path))
}
